NSIB Begins Investigation Into Jigawa Tanker Explosion
Share on WhatsAppShare on FacebookShare on XTelegram

The Nigerian Safety Investigation Bureau (NSIB), on Thursday, said it has launched investigation into the petrol tanker explosion at Majia town, Taura local government area of Jigawa State.

Advertisement

LEADERSHIP reports that the tragic incident happened on late Tuesday, October 16, 2024, resulting in the death of over 100 people and leaving many severely injured.

A press statement by the director, Public Affairs and Family Assistance, NSIB, Bimbo Oladeji, said the incident happened around 11pm when a petrol tanker, from Kano State en route Nguru in Yobe State, lost control and crashed, spilling its inflammable contents.

She, however, disclosed that as residents gathered to scoop the fuel, the tanker exploded, resulting in a massive inferno.

“In line with our mandate to investigate accidents across all transportation sectors, the NSIB has deployed a go-team of experts to investigate the accident. The team will assess the circumstances surrounding the crash and the explosion to identify causal factors and provide safety recommendations aimed at preventing future occurrences.

“We extend our heartfelt condolences to the families affected by this devastating accident. The NSIB is committed to uncovering the cause of the explosion and ensuring that safety lessons are learned,” the statement quoted Captain Alex Badeh Jr., Director General of the NSIB as saying.

Oladeji, however, reiterated the danger of scooping fuel from fallen tankers, saying it’s very dangerous and poses grave dangers.

“Further updates on the investigation will be communicated as the NSIB team gathers and analyses evidence from the scene. In the meantime, citizens are reminded of the grave danger posed by scooping fuel from tanker accidents and are urged to avoid such scenes,” she stated.
